Archivists and curators vs Electrical engineers Salary (2025)
How do Archivists and curators and Electrical engineers sal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Electrical engineers earns £26,283 more per year (83% higher)
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Archivists and curators | Electrical engineers |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£31,835 | £58,118 | -£26,283 |
| Mean Annual | £31,866 | £60,586 | -£28,720 |
| Monthly | £2,653 | £4,843 | -£2,190 |
| Weekly | £612 | £1,118 | -£506 |
| Hourly | £15.31 | £27.94 | -£12.63 |
